Under the hood
Toraverb was never meant to be an emulation
approximation or a recreation. We did not implement any "off-the-shelf" algorithm or impulse response. Unlike a classic unit such as spring
room
hall or plate
Toraverb is a concept in its own right. Using a set of easily accessible parameters
it allows the user to create practically ANY type of algorithmic reverb. Our goal was to create something which would sound beautiful no matter where the knobs are.
Reverb is a critical effect in a mix. A good digital reverb depends on the algorithms used and their implementation quality. Usually
reverb is used as a send effect in which many channels in a mix are routed to it. If a poorly designed plug-in or hardware unit is used
the end result is tinnier/muddier mixes
with reverb tails sounding like theyβre being torn off inhumanely.

Built-in ducker - Essential functionality in the most studio situations. Toraverb features a built-in ducker
which's compresses FX signal's amplitude proportionally to the loudness of dry / unprocessed input
thus saving an overall output signal energy.
